I tow my CRX behind a motorhome.
When I do, it racks up the miles on the Odometer.
Is there a fix so it will show the miles when I drive but NOT when I tow?
I fuse to pull or a switch I can install or ????

yeah pull the guages out and there be two harness plugs and the speedo cable just unclip it and there it is
